Stone Age Cycladic Statue Head
3RD MILLENNIUM BC
9" (2 kg, 23cm).
A carved marble stylised idol head with sloped posture, D-shaped face with reserved triangular nose, ledge to the reverse, long slender neck.
Provenance
Private collection, London, UK; formed 1970s-1980s; formerly in the private French collection of M. Foroughi; acquired in the 1960s; accompanied by a copy of Art Loss Register certificate number S00097176, and an original French Archaeological Passport number 156504.
